The Enigma of the Vanishing Village: A Time-Weaving Sorceress' Tale

In the heart of the ancient land of Luminara, there lay a village known only to the most intrepid travelers. This village, named Elysium, was a place of wonder and mystery, for it was said that every night, as the moon rose, the village would simply disappear. It left no trace behind, and those who dared to seek it out would find only a desolate landscape where Elysium once stood.

The villagers spoke of the Time-Weaving Sorceress, a figure of legend who was said to possess the power to manipulate time itself. She was the guardian of Elysium, and her wisdom was the only thing that kept the village from being consumed by the void that lay between worlds.

One fateful night, a young traveler named Aria stumbled upon the ruins of Elysium. She had heard tales of the Time-Weaving Sorceress and her power to control time, and she felt a strange pull towards the vanishing village. As the moon rose, Aria witnessed the village's disappearance, and she was engulfed in a blinding light.

When she awoke, Aria found herself in a room adorned with ancient runes and artifacts. The Time-Weaving Sorceress appeared before her, her eyes twinkling with ancient knowledge.

"Sorceress," Aria gasped, "how did I get here?"

The sorceress smiled, her voice echoing with the wisdom of ages. "You have been chosen, Aria. The balance of time is threatened, and only you can restore it."

Aria's heart raced with fear and excitement. "What must I do?"

The sorceress gestured towards the runes on the wall. "Elysium is more than a village; it is a bridge between our world and the realm of shadows. The moon's light has grown stronger, and it is pulling Elysium closer to the darkness. If we do not act, the realm of shadows will consume us all."

Aria felt a surge of determination. "I will help you, sorceress. But how?"

The sorceress handed Aria a small, ornate box. "This is the Time-Weaving Orb. It holds the power to manipulate time. You must use it to travel back in time and find the source of the imbalance."

Aria took the orb, feeling its warmth and power. "But how far back do I need to go?"

The sorceress's eyes narrowed. "To the very beginning. To the time when Elysium was first created."

Aria nodded, understanding the gravity of her mission. She took a deep breath and closed her eyes, focusing on the orb. The room around her blurred, and she felt herself being pulled through a vortex of time.

When she opened her eyes, she was standing in a lush, verdant forest. The air was thick with the scent of pine and the sound of birdsong filled her ears. She looked around, trying to find any sign of Elysium.

Suddenly, a figure appeared before her. It was an ancient sorcerer, his eyes glowing with power. "You have found the path," he said, his voice echoing with authority. "But be warned, the journey will be treacherous."

Aria nodded, her resolve unshaken. "I am ready."

The ancient sorcerer handed her a scroll. "This scroll contains the knowledge you need to restore balance. But remember, time is a delicate tapestry, and you must tread carefully."

Aria took the scroll and began to read. The knowledge within it was complex, but she felt a connection to it, as if it was a part of her very essence.

As she delved deeper into the scroll, Aria discovered that the source of the imbalance was a dark sorcerer who had sought to control the Time-Weaving Orb for his own gain. He had manipulated the moon's light, causing Elysium to vanish and the realm of shadows to grow stronger.

Aria realized that she must defeat this dark sorcerer to restore balance to the world. She followed the trail of runes left by the ancient sorcerer, navigating through the treacherous landscape of time.

The journey was filled with challenges, from ancient traps to the perils of time itself. Aria's resolve was tested, but she pressed on, driven by her determination to save Elysium and the world.

Finally, Aria reached the dark sorcerer's lair. The air was thick with the scent of decay, and the darkness was palpable. The dark sorcerer appeared before her, his eyes gleaming with malevolence.

"You have come too late," he hissed. "The realm of shadows is mine."

Aria took a deep breath, focusing on the Time-Weaving Orb. She chanted the incantation from the scroll, and the orb began to glow with a fierce light.

The dark sorcerer lunged at her, but Aria dodged with ease. She raised the orb, and the light from it enveloped the dark sorcerer, burning away his darkness.

With a final, fiery explosion, the dark sorcerer was vanquished, and the realm of shadows began to recede. Aria felt the weight of the Time-Weaving Orb lift from her shoulders, and she knew that the balance of time had been restored.

As the moon began to rise, Aria felt the ground beneath her feet solidify. Elysium was back, and the villagers were safe.

The Time-Weaving Sorceress appeared before her, her eyes filled with gratitude. "You have done it, Aria. You have saved us all."

Aria smiled, feeling a sense of accomplishment. "I am just glad I could help."

The sorceress nodded. "You have shown great courage and wisdom. You are a true hero, Aria."

Aria looked around at the restored village, her heart swelling with pride. She had faced the darkness and emerged victorious, and she knew that her journey was far from over. The Time-Weaving Sorceress had given her a gift, and she was determined to use it wisely.

As the sun began to rise, Aria knew that she would always be a guardian of time, a protector of the balance between worlds. And with the Time-Weaving Orb in her possession, she was ready to face whatever challenges lay ahead.
